Descripción del trabajo - Lead Mechanical Engineer

Job Description Summary

We are seeking a Lead Professional in Mechanical Engineering to serve as a key technical contributor within the MH Fabrications team. In this role, you will contribute to the design, development, and implementation of mechanical components for wind turbines, spanning the entire product life cycle from concept creation to field support. You will apply your technical expertise to develop innovative designs, ensure compliance with pertinent standards, and deliver safe, reliable, and high-quality solutions.

Job Description

Key Responsibilities

  • Technical Contribution: Contribute to designing fabricated wind turbine components and resolving mechanically complex engineering challenges.
  • Project Execution: Support New Product Introduction (NPI) programs, technology integration, and field issue resolution with a primary focus on safety, quality, and reliability.
  • Product Safety and EHS: Contribute to the identification and mitigation of risks for safety-critical components, ensuring all designs meet tolerable risk levels. Support the resolution of SAFER cases by working cross-functionally to assist in the completion of action items.
  • Systems Thinking & Integration: Apply a "Systems Thinking" mindset to help integrate components into the overall turbine design. Assess tradeoffs and communicate the implications of component changes on the wider machine.
  • Compliance & Standards: Apply all relevant design practices, industry regulations, and standards to the design of mechanical components. Maintain up-to-date knowledge of engineering requirements affecting wind turbine systems.
  • Tool & Process Improvement: Contribute to continuous improvement of design practices and engineering tools. Apply and support standardized analysis and calculation methodologies to ensure a rigorous engineering approach across projects.
  • Risk Management: Actively participate in risk identification and mitigation activities, contributing to rigorous DFMEA practices to ensure that all potential failure modes are proactively identified, addressed, and validated against quality and reliability standards.
  • Prototyping & Validation: Contribute to the conceptualization, prototyping, and physical testing of mechanical systems. Support the resolution of technical issues or defects identified during the validation and testing phases.

Required Qualifications

  • Education: Bachelor's or Master's Degree in Mechanical Engineering or related field.
  • Experience: Minimum 3-5 years of product design and development experience, ideally in the wind industry.
  • Technical Proficiency: Strong working knowledge of mechanical design (static, fatigue, fracture), FEM (Finite Element Method), and manufacturing processes (Sheet metal, machining, welding).
  • Software Tools: Strong knowledge of CAD (Unigraphics NX 3D-CAD preferred), CAE tools (Ansys, Hypermesh), and PLM tools.
  • Travel: Ability and willingness to travel up to 20% of the time.

Desired Characteristics

  • Proven track record of structured problem-solving (RCA) and Lean design principles.
  • Strong interpersonal skills with experience working in international, multi-disciplinary project teams (Electrical, Structural, and Systems).
  • Expertise in wind turbine structural components and internal mechanical systems.
